Dyckia platyphylla....hummmmm is it real or a real fake or the Great Pretender from the Dyckia World?


Dyckia platyphylla is at least a highly suspicious species.
Has it ever existed in Nature?
Up to now none has found it anywhere but in cultivation everywhere.
It is claimed to be found in Bahia but the place is well known and never once a single plant was found.
Many species were found there but none that looked close to any platyphylla.


Is this the Great Pretender?


Topping all these facts there is one at least very very indicative.
When you cross Dyckia mer-lapostollei and Dyckia brevifolia you get
to a plant very very close to Dyckia platyphylla. Even an expert would not tell them apart.


Some Dyckia Mundo a hybrid from Dyckia marnier-lapostollei and Dyckia brevifolia crossing are so Dyckia platyphylla no one can tell them apart even when blooming.
